Таблица трассировки ⎯ это инструмент, который используется в компьютерной графике для создания 3D-изображений. Она является основной частью алгоритмов трассировки лучей, которые позволяют смоделировать процесс отслеживания пути света от источника до объекта на изображении. В таблице трассировки каждая строка содержит информацию о номере строки, значении переменных на этом шаге и результате выполнения оператора. Такая таблица позволяет программистам понять и отследить ход выполнения программы, что может быть полезно при поиске ошибок и проблем. Применение таблиц трассировки может быть найдено в различных областях, таких как компьютерная графика, разработка программного обеспечения и тестирование ПО.
Значение и использование таблиц трассировки
Таблицы трассировки имеют важное значение в различных областях, таких как компьютерная графика, разработка программного обеспечения и тестирование ПО. Они позволяют программистам и разработчикам легко отследить ход выполнения программы и проверить правильность ее работы.
В компьютерной графике таблицы трассировки используются для создания 3D-изображений. Они являются основной частью алгоритмов трассировки лучей٫ которые моделируют путь света от источника до объекта на изображении. В таблице каждая строка представляет отдельный оператор программы и содержит информацию о номере строки٫ значениях переменных и результате выполнения оператора.
В разработке программного обеспечения таблицы трассировки используются для понимания работы программы и выявления возможных ошибок. Они позволяют программистам следить за изменениями значений переменных и контролировать выполнение операторов. Таблицы трассировки помогают легко найти и исправить ошибки в коде.
В тестировании ПО таблицы трассировки используются для отслеживания хода выполнения программы и контроля за правильностью работы. Они позволяют тестировщикам проследить каждый шаг программы и убедиться, что программа выполняет требуемые действия и возвращает ожидаемые результаты.
Таким образом, таблицы трассировки являются важным инструментом в работе разработчиков и тестировщиков. Они упрощают отладку программ, обнаружение ошибок и повышают качество программного обеспечения. Благодаря таблицам трассировки можно более эффективно контролировать ход выполнения программы и принимать меры по устранению проблемных ситуаций.
Создание таблицы трассировки
Для создания таблицы трассировки необходимо следовать определенным шагам. Вот основные этапы процесса создания таблицы трассировки⁚
Идентификация переменных⁚ Определите все переменные, которые будут использоваться в программе или процессе, который вы хотите отследить. Это могут быть числовые переменные, логические значения или любые другие типы данных, необходимые для выполнения операций.
Определение операторов⁚ Определите все операторы, которые необходимо выполнить в программе или процессе. Это может быть любая команда, инструкция или действие, которое нужно выполнить на каждом шаге.
Создание таблицы⁚ Создайте таблицу с необходимыми столбцами. Обычно таблица трассировки включает в себя столбцы для номера строки, значений переменных и результатов выполнения операторов.
Заполнение таблицы⁚ Заполните таблицу значениями переменных и результатами выполнения операторов для каждого шага. Начните с первого шага и последовательно заполняйте таблицу до последнего.
Анализ результатов⁚ Проанализируйте заполненную таблицу трассировки, чтобы найти возможные ошибки или проблемы в программе или процессе. Обратите внимание на изменения значений переменных, проверьте правильность выполнения операторов.
Исправление и повторное выполнение⁚ Если обнаружены ошибки, внесите необходимые исправления и повторно выполните программу или процесс с учетом изменений.
Создание таблицы трассировки является важным шагом при отладке программы и понимании ее работы. Она помогает разработчикам отслеживать значения переменных и контролировать ход выполнения операторов, что позволяет улучшить качество программного обеспечения и обнаружить возможные ошибки.
Применение таблиц трассировки в различных областях
Таблицы трассировки находят применение в различных областях, где необходимо отслеживать и анализировать выполнение программ, процессов или операций. Вот некоторые из областей, где таблицы трассировки широко используются⁚
Компьютерная графика⁚ В компьютерной графике таблицы трассировки играют важную роль при создании 3D-изображений. Алгоритмы трассировки лучей используются для отслеживания пути света от источника до объекта на изображении. Таблицы трассировки содержат информацию о значении переменных и результате выполнения операторов, что помогает моделировать путь света и создавать фотореалистичные изображения.
Дизайн программного обеспечения⁚ В разработке программного обеспечения таблицы трассировки используются для анализа и отладки программ. Они помогают программистам отслеживать изменения переменных и контролировать выполнение операторов, что упрощает обнаружение и исправление ошибок.
Тестирование программного обеспечения⁚ В процессе тестирования программного обеспечения таблицы трассировки используются для проверки правильности выполнения программы или процесса. Они позволяют тестировщикам отслеживать ход выполнения, контролировать значения переменных и проверять соответствие ожидаемым результатам.
Анализ производительности⁚ В области анализа производительности таблицы трассировки применяются для отслеживания и измерения времени выполнения конкретных операций или алгоритмов в программе. Они позволяют выявить узкие места и оптимизировать код для улучшения производительности.
Обучение и образование⁚ В учебных целях таблицы трассировки используются для демонстрации выполнения программ или процессов. Они помогают студентам лучше понять работу программы и отслеживать переменные и операторы на каждом шаге выполнения.
Таблицы трассировки являются полезным инструментом в различных областях, где требуется отслеживание и анализ выполнения программ, процессов или операций. Они упрощают отладку программного обеспечения, обнаружение и исправление ошибок, а также повышают эффективность и производительность при разработке и тестировании программ.
Таблицы трассировки являются важным инструментом в различных областях, таких как компьютерная графика, разработка программного обеспечения и тестирование ПО. Они позволяют отслеживать и анализировать выполнение программ, процессов и операций, что помогает выявлять ошибки, контролировать значения переменных и улучшать качество продукта.
В компьютерной графике таблицы трассировки используются для создания 3D-изображений и моделирования пути света на изображении. В разработке программного обеспечения они помогают программистам отслеживать изменения переменных и контролировать выполнение операторов٫ что упрощает обнаружение и исправление ошибок. В тестировании ПО таблицы трассировки позволяют проверять правильность выполнения программы и отслеживать ход выполнения.
Применение таблиц трассировки также может быть найдено в анализе производительности, обучении и образовании; Они помогают измерять и оптимизировать производительность программы, улучшают понимание работы программы и используются в учебных целях.